-e- also in your OP you have a static range, that's not what you want. You want to change your open shove range based on position and the people after you. Your button and sb open shove range should be way wider than your utg range for example. You'll find all this in the book tho

I doubt theres any book completely relevant to 180's. You should be doing -ev shoves all the time if its the best spot and your not adjusting to antes. The hands you listed are the hands your shoving when your above 10bb if you get them below 10bb your lovin life

If your this tight a villian shoving any 2 after antes is going to do better then you and i aint jokin
